  • Water

    This month’s blog party theme, water, got me to thinking about the very practical ways in which water, and the excess or lack thereof, has such an effect on my life as a home gardener and a photographer.

    Water has ruled this summer. The drought of 2012 is in the history books. As much as I feel so very clever for having purchased 4 water barrels to collect rainwater, I somehow feel less so when carrying sheetrock buckets of it out to the garden on an 80 degree morning. I know there must be an easier way, yet the drip irrigation hoses just don’t seem to work. The upside: fabulous tomatoes and melons that we have been enjoying this week. And a real appreciation all the hard work farmers do to get us our food.

    Professional speaking, weather is an obsession for photographers who work outside. I’ll start projecting for every event with the 7 day forecast (Matt Noyes hour by hour forecast on NECN is my favorite), then its a roller coaster ride of good news and/or bad news till the day of the wedding. Then I just start watching the sky to tweak my shooting schedules and locations.

    For the record, an ideal weather forecast for me: Wake up to beautiful blue skies with puffy clouds on the wedding morning; high clouds come in for an afternoon photo session, then thin out for a gorgeous sunset. Rain showers after midnight (for the garden).
